Sue VandeWoude is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Virology and Genetics. According to data from OpenAlex, Sue VandeWoude has authored 166 papers receiving a total of 3.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 85 papers in Epidemiology, 76 papers in Virology and 38 papers in Genetics. Recurrent topics in Sue VandeWoude’s work include HIV Research and Treatment (69 papers), Herpesvirus Infections and Treatments (64 papers) and Animal Disease Management and Epidemiology (33 papers). Sue VandeWoude is often cited by papers focused on HIV Research and Treatment (69 papers), Herpesvirus Infections and Treatments (64 papers) and Animal Disease Management and Epidemiology (33 papers). Sue VandeWoude collaborates with scholars based in United States, Australia and Germany. Sue VandeWoude's co-authors include Kevin R. Crooks, Scott Carver, Jennifer L. Troyer, Ryan M. Troyer and Michael R. Lappin and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and Environmental Science & Technology.
